代码随想录一刷day48
发布人:shili8
发布时间:2025-01-20 15:14
阅读次数:0
**代码随想录 一刷 Day48**
今天是2023年2月14日,距离我开始学习编程已经过去了48天。虽然进展还不错,但仍然有很多地方需要改进。
### **一、前言**
在前面的几篇博文中,我提到了我的学习目标和计划。在这48天里,我尝试了一些新的东西,包括但不限于:
* 学习了Python语言* 掌握了基本的数据结构和算法知识* 实践了机器学习和深度学习的概念### **二、今日内容**
今天我将分享我的一些体会和感受,以及我在这48天里所学到的东西。
#### **2.1 Python语言**
Python是目前最流行的编程语言之一。它的简单性和易用性使得很多初学者都喜欢使用它。在这48天里,我学习了Python的基本语法,包括变量、数据类型、控制结构等。
#例子:定义一个变量并打印它x =5print(x)
#### **2.2 数据结构和算法**
在这48天里,我也学到了很多关于数据结构和算法的知识。包括但不限于:
* 数组和链表* 栈和队列* 二叉树和图
#例子:使用栈来实现一个逆序函数def reverse(x): stack = [] while x: stack.append(x %10) x //=10 return ''.join(map(str, reversed(stack)))
#### **2.3机器学习和深度学习**
在这48天里,我也尝试了一些关于机器学习和深度学习的概念。包括但不限于:
* 回归和分类* 神经网络和卷积神经网络
#例子:使用Keras来实现一个简单的神经网络from keras.models import Sequentialfrom keras.layers import Densemodel = Sequential() model.add(Dense(64, activation='relu', input_shape=(784,))) model.add(Dense(32, activation='relu')) model.add(Dense(10, activation='softmax')) model.compile(optimizer='adam', loss='sparse_categorical_crossentropy', metrics=['accuracy'])
### **三、结论**
在这48天里,我学到了很多东西,包括但不限于Python语言、数据结构和算法、机器学习和深度学习。虽然进展还不错,但仍然有很多地方需要改进。
**四、后记**
感谢您阅读我的博文。如果您有任何问题或建议,请随时告诉我。我将继续努力,希望能在未来的一些日子里实现更大的进步。